Holter monitor electrocardiography is used to Correct Answers
Assess the rate and rhythm of the heart during daily activities.
Evaluate patients with unexplained chest pain.
Detect cardiac dysrhythmias that are intermittent in nature.
Assess the effectiveness of a pacemaker.

List some reasons why should the veins of the hands be used as
a venipuncture site only as a last resort? Correct Answers
They have a tendency to roll.
They are more difficult to stick.
The procedure is more uncomfortable for the patient.
